对象存储能用什么系统存储,对象存储系统适配指南,主流平台对比与选型建议
- 综合资讯
- 2025-05-22 02:04:43
- 1

对象存储系统采用分布式架构实现海量数据的高扩展性存储,支持多协议访问(HTTP/S3、Swift等),适用于非结构化数据、日志文件及冷热数据分层管理,适配指南需重点考量...
对象存储系统采用分布式架构实现海量数据的高扩展性存储,支持多协议访问(HTTP/S3、Swift等),适用于非结构化数据、日志文件及冷热数据分层管理,适配指南需重点考量数据安全(加密传输/存储)、多区域容灾能力、API兼容性及成本优化策略,主流平台对比显示:AWS S3生态最完善,适合全球化部署;阿里云OSS与腾讯云COS在政企市场合规性优势显著;MinIO、Ceph等开源方案灵活但需自建运维体系,选型建议:大型企业优先评估多云兼容性及SLA保障,初创公司可侧重成本与开源性,金融/医疗行业需强化数据脱敏与审计功能,混合云场景建议采用API网关统一接入不同存储服务。
(全文约3280字,原创内容占比92%)
对象存储技术演进与核心价值 1.1 技术发展脉络 对象存储作为分布式存储技术的第三代形态,经历了文件存储(1980s)、块存储(1990s)到对象存储(2000s)的迭代,2014年AWS S3服务上线标志着对象存储进入主流阶段,其基于键值对存储、全球分布式架构和API标准化三大特征,实现了PB级数据存储的突破性发展。
图片来源于网络,如有侵权联系删除
2 核心架构要素 现代对象存储系统包含四大核心组件:
- 分布式元数据服务器(DMS):采用一致性哈希算法实现键值存储,典型实现如Ceph的Mon/Wal架构
- 数据存储集群:支持纠删码(Erasure Coding)、MDS多副本存储等策略
- API网关:提供RESTful/S3兼容接口,如MinIO的模拟S3层
- 数据平面:采用SSD缓存加速(Triton)、冷热数据分层(Alluxio)
3 性能指标体系 关键性能参数包括:
- 吞吐量:S3 v4接口支持10^6对象/秒写入(AWS白皮书)
- 延迟:Ceph RGW提供<50ms响应(CNCF基准测试)
- 可用性:99.999999999% SLA(Google Cloud Storage)
- 成本效率:纠删码实现99.9999999%数据冗余(3+9配置)
主流对象存储系统全景分析 2.1 云厂商原生方案
- AWS S3:全球42区域部署,支持版本控制(1年保留)、生命周期管理(过渡到Glacier)
- Azure Blob Storage:集成于Azure Stack Edge,支持边缘计算场景
- Google Cloud Storage:支持BigQuery原生集成,延迟优化至50ms内
- 阿里云OSS:针对东南亚市场优化,提供CDN直放功能
2 开源社区项目
- MinIO:MIT协议开源,支持S3 API 3.0,部署密度达128节点/集群
- Alluxio:内存计算引擎,冷热数据延迟差异缩小至1:5() 实测- Ceph RGW:Ceph对象网关,支持CRUSH算法自动均衡
- MinIO Serverless:无服务器架构,资源利用率提升40%
3 行业定制方案
- 华为FusionStorage:支持多协议(S3/NFS/SMB),存储效率达98%
- 华为云OBS:与昇腾AI深度集成,实现数据预处理流水线
- 海康威视CVS:视频存储专用,支持H.265/HEVC编码
- 飞腾DataBus:国产化替代方案,支持国密算法
4 混合云解决方案
- OpenStack Swift:社区驱动,支持跨云存储(CloudInteroperability)
- CNCF Crossplane:多云基础设施抽象,实现S3 API统一管理
- Veeam S3:备份数据与生产环境解耦,RPO<1秒
系统选型决策模型 3.1 评估维度矩阵 构建包含6个一级指标、18个二级指标的评估体系:
- 数据规模(对象数/数据量/增长曲线)
- 性能需求(写入/读取并发比)
- 成本结构(存储/请求/吞吐成本)
- 安全合规(等保2.0/GDPR/CCPA)
- 扩展弹性(节点添加成本/自动扩容)
- 生态兼容(API版本/SDK支持)
2 实施路线图 四阶段部署流程:
- 试点验证(3-6个月):选择典型业务场景进行POC
- 架构设计(2-4周):制定存储分层策略(热/温/冷/归档)
- 系统部署(1-3周):实施多AZ容灾架构(跨可用区复制)
- 持续优化(持续):建立存储成本看板(AWS Cost Explorer替代方案)
典型应用场景解决方案 4.1 媒体流媒体
- 方案要素:HLS转码+CDN缓存+对象存储
- 实施案例:某视频平台采用阿里云OSS+CDN直放,QPS提升300%
- 关键技术:FMP4分段存储、HLS转码流水线
2 金融科技
- 方案要素:交易数据湖+实时分析
- 实施案例:某券商使用MinIO部署交易日志存储,查询响应<50ms
- 技术要点:Kafka+MinIO流式写入、Parquet格式存储
3 物联网平台
- 方案要素:设备注册+数据存储+告警
- 实施案例:某智慧城市项目采用AWS IoT Core+S3,管理500万设备
- 架构设计:设备ID哈希分区、数据自动归档
4 工业互联网
- 方案要素:设备全生命周期管理
- 实施案例:三一重工部署Ceph RGW,存储效率达96%
- 技术创新:数字孪生数据关联存储
技术挑战与应对策略 5.1 数据安全防护
图片来源于网络,如有侵权联系删除
- 加密体系:服务端加密(SSE-S3)+客户端加密(AWS KMS)
- 防火墙策略:Nginx+AWS WAF组合方案
- 变更审计:基于Object Access logs的日志分析
2 成本优化实践
- 分层策略:对象年龄>30天自动转存(AWS Glacier)
- 热温冷分级:Alluxio智能分层(冷数据访问延迟>1000ms)
- 生命周期管理:自动删除过期对象(MinIO+ самосжигание)
3 性能调优技巧
- 缓存策略:Redis+Alluxio混合缓存(热点命中率>90%)
- 分片优化:对象大小设置(4MB-100MB最佳)
- 带宽管理:S3批量操作(PutMultiObject)提升写入效率
未来技术演进趋势 6.1 AI融合方向
- 智能存储:AutoML预测存储需求(AWS Forecast)
- 对象标注:基于AI的元数据自动生成
- 流式分析:Kafka+对象存储实时处理
2 边缘计算集成
- 边缘节点:EdgeX Foundry部署对象存储
- 数据预处理:KubeEdge+对象存储流水线
3 绿色计算实践
- 能效优化:冷数据封存(HDD+磁带混合)
- 分布式存储:Ceph的CRUSH算法优化
- 重复数据消除:Zstandard压缩算法
实施案例深度剖析 7.1 某电商平台冷热分离项目
- 原问题:月存储成本超$50万
- 解决方案:Alluxio+OSS混合架构
- 实施效果:热数据存储成本降低62%,访问延迟<200ms
2 金融风控数据湖建设
- 技术栈:MinIO+AWS Glue+Spark
- 数据治理:对象标签体系(业务域/数据敏感度)
- 监控指标:对象访问热力图、存储利用率曲线
3 工业质检AI训练平台
- 存储方案:Ceph RGW+对象存储分类
- 训练效率:数据加载速度提升5倍
- 模型管理:对象版本控制+模型关联存储
总结与展望 对象存储已从单一存储层演进为数据服务基础设施,其核心价值体现在:
- 全球化数据统一管理(跨云/跨地域复制)
- 按需扩展的弹性架构(分钟级扩容)
- 智能化的存储分层(Alluxio实践)
- 安全合规的闭环(对象审计追踪)
未来技术演进将呈现三大特征:
- 存储即服务(Storage-as-a-Service)成为主流交付模式
- 对象存储与计算存储的深度融合(对象存储计算化)
- 绿色存储技术(低碳数据中心/光学存储)突破
建议企业建立"存储中台"架构,通过统一存储控制平面(如CNCF Open Storage项目)实现多云对象存储的统一管理,同时结合AIops实现存储资源的智能调度,在实施过程中,需重点关注存储成本优化(目标<0.02美元/GB/月)和合规性管理(对象生命周期控制精度达分钟级)。
(注:文中所有技术参数均基于2023年Q2最新技术文档,实施案例经过脱敏处理,核心方法论已申请专利保护)
本文链接:https://www.zhitaoyun.cn/2266275.html
发表评论